Disney World, Universal Orlando Stop COVID-19 Temperature Checks.

The two Florida amusement
parks are easing their
COVID-19 protocols.
In addition to doing away with temperature checks, Universal Orlando is also reducing its social distancing requirements from 6 feet to 3 feet.
Still, most of our original safety protocols remain unchanged...from wearing face coverings across our Resort to our ongoing dedication to cleanliness and sanitization, Universal Orlando, via statement.
Disney World says it will begin phasing out temperature checks starting May 16.
On May 3,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is issued an executive order recalling public COVID-19 restrictions, including mask mandates.
However, privately-owned
businesses can choose to
keep safety protocols in effect.
Disney and Universal will still require masks for the time being, among other things
